Course Content

• Understanding Child Rights and the UNCRC
• Storytelling Techniques for Advocacy and Social Change
• Developing Compelling Narratives for Child Rights
• Multimedia Storytelling for Child Rights Activism (Video, Audio, Images)
• Ethical Considerations in Child Rights Storytelling
• Reaching Your Audience: Strategies for Effective Communication
• Impact Measurement and Evaluation in Child Rights Storytelling Campaigns
• Collaborating with Children and Communities for Authentic Storytelling
• Child Rights Activism: Case Studies and Best Practices

Career path

Career Opportunities in Child Rights Advocacy (UK)

Role Description
Child Rights Campaigner Develop and implement campaigns to advocate for children's rights, leveraging storytelling skills for maximum impact. Strong communication and advocacy skills essential.
Children's Advocacy Programme Manager Manage and oversee programs focused on children's welfare, using data-driven storytelling to demonstrate program effectiveness and secure further funding. Requires strong management and program evaluation skills.
Child Protection Specialist Investigate cases of child abuse and neglect, prepare compelling reports using storytelling techniques to present evidence effectively. Requires detailed knowledge of child protection laws and procedures.
Communications Officer (Child Rights) Develop and implement communication strategies to raise awareness of child rights issues, crafting narratives that resonate with diverse audiences. Excellent writing and storytelling abilities are key.
